Fascinating historic photographs reveal that the Cotswolds has always been outstandingly beautiful and quintessentially rural England. The images show that much of the area looks almost exactly as it did in the late 19th and early 20th centuries, with ancient woodland, rolling fields, and chocolate-box villages. The photographs capture the timeless beauty of Mickleton, Kiftsgate Court, Cheltenham's Promenade, Lechlade, Lower Slaughter, Fairford, Bourton-on-the-Hill, Burford, Swinbrook, and Stow-on-the-Wold. The Cotswolds is known for its preserved historic charm and is a popular tourist destination.
